Abstract

Objective- The research presents the efficiency and importance of the studied theme, the capitalization of creative education through the interaction of arts and creation. Thus, creativity being the main statement that motivated this qualitative study coming to explain clear principles of formation of a modern personality, capable of continuous adaptation to the unpredictable challenges and conjunctures of life, which can be defined only through the prism of the process of creative development.Methodology- Our study focuses on the development and applicative role of creativity through all methods and forms of related arts- architecture, urbanism, interior design, visual arts, applied in the curriculum of the higher school of architecture in the Republic of Moldova, which have an important role in the moral formation of personality skills, of the specialist in architecture, a modern person who can easily integrate into the labor market.Findings- Finally, the flexibility of approach and implementation of creativity in the study program, demonstrates through our work through multiple examples of outstanding personalities formed within the higher school of architecture in the Republic of Moldova, who only through the strategy of creativity offered them a wide spectrum of professional affirmation activities and the opportunity to work in a preferred field.
